Output 22699f8afdfb396f2dec835048f73af3ef5afbd34ee15d8d735b47557fda8307:4

value
149787747
script pubkey
OP_HASH160 OP_PUSHBYTES_20 667f3e135e2bbffcad98ebae89dcb313a3fadd19 OP_EQUAL
address
3B2yH5CQ1PqyUtWZaFx9hHkyfmTQh8UJ6w
transaction
22699f8afdfb396f2dec835048f73af3ef5afbd34ee15d8d735b47557fda8307
spent
true